God willing I'll spring for a new pair of (tubeless) wheels for the Fargo,
after Mark Chandler reported that his 55 mm-labeled Kendas measure 60 mm on
these 30 mm wide rims. Currently, my 50 mm-labeled Furious Freds measure 55
mm on my 44 mm SnoCat SLs.

I want a lighter wheelset than that composed of the ~700+ gram SnoCat SLs
with the 200 grams or so of Gorilla tape required to build up the bed for
the 200 gram 26" mtb tube-hack liner. Velocity claims 425 grams for the
Blunt SSes, and even if they are lyig, as they probably are, 200 grams less
than 750 or so will be welcome.

So, question to those of you who have used the Blunt SSes: are they sturdy?
Do you find that tires at least match their labeled width on them? Are they
reasonably sturdy? I don't do big drop-offs, but I do hit rocks and roots.
I'd be using 32 hole rims.

Are there other, wider 700C rims that weigh under 600 grams? (I use disk
brakes, so I don't need a brake track.)

Is the Velocity P 35 available in tubeless design? Is it still made? My
quick search turned up little on it.
